On another note, if there was a no contact order issued as a result of the charge, you can't have contact with him....that means you can't live with him until the case is heard. Simple Battery in a domestic situation is taken very seriously in most states.....violating a no contact order resulting from such a case is taken even more seriously and in my experience is almost always jail time. I suggest one of you move out until the case is heard. If he is in the military, his CO should be able to set him up temporarily in a barracks on base.
